Book Overview
The book "Strength of Materials" by Dr. B.C. Punmia is a comprehensive textbook that covers the fundamental principles of strength of materials, including:
- Introduction to Strength of Materials: Definition, importance, and applications of strength of materials.
- Properties of Materials: Elastic and plastic properties, stress-strain curves, and material testing.
- Simple Stresses and Strains: Axial loading, bending, torsion, and shear stresses.
- Bending of Beams: Types of beams, loading, and bending moment diagrams.
- Torsion of Shafts: Torsional loading, twisting, and torque transmission.
- Deflection of Beams: Methods of finding deflection, including Macaulay's method and moment-area method.
- Energy Methods: Strain energy, work-energy method, and virtual work.
- Columns and Struts: Types of columns, buckling, and stability.

Why Students Prefer Punmia
- Numerical Problems: Each chapter contains a massive repository of solved problems. For every derivation, there are 5 to 10 numerical examples.
- Theory vs. Practice: The book perfectly balances theoretical derivations (for exams) and practical design problems (for projects).
- Standard Units: All problems are solved in SI units, matching current university guidelines.
